DeepRise is an autonomous multi-agent AI coding system that builds, tests, and improves apps end-to-end with minimal input. Once given a direction, swarms of agents continue working independently until the task is done — including proper real-user-style testing and iteration.
- Super Agent: Acts as the CEO of the agent swarm — coordinates all other agents, receives and consolidates their feedback, sets strategies, and instructs each agent on what to do to drive the project forward.
- Orchestration Agent: Designs software architecture, creates implementation plans, and generates detailed TODO lists for developers.
- Developer Agent: Implements features, writes code, and coordinates with the test agent to ensure functionality.
- Test Agent: Creates and runs comprehensive tests to validate code quality and reliability.
- User-Level Test Agent: Simulates real-world user interactions to identify issues like a real human user.
- Runtime QA Agent: Runs the application in an isolated environment, validates real user flows, and coordinates fixes with other agents.
- Explore Agent: Searches and analyzes codebases to answer questions or locate specific patterns.
- Code Review Agent: Reviews code for adherence to best practices, readability, and maintainability.
- Security Agent: Identifies and mitigates security vulnerabilities in the code.
- DevOps Agent: Automates deployment pipelines, monitors infrastructure, pushes to github, and ensures smooth operations.
DeepRise uses a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) approach to manage memory efficiently, ensuring relevant context is always available.
